Latest Patents

Among his latest patents is a fabrication process and package design for use in a micro-machined seismometer. This invention features an accelerometer or seismometer that utilizes an in-plane suspension geometry. The design includes a suspension plate formed from a single piece, which integrates an external frame, a pair of flexural elements, and a proof mass. The flexural elements allow the proof mass to move in the sensitive direction while restricting off-axis movement. Additionally, the device incorporates intermediate frames to minimize off-axis motion and can include a dampening structure for enhanced performance. Another significant patent involves a method of attaching two wafers in a seismometer, which includes forming a patterned wetting metal layer and aligning the wafers with solder balls for bonding.
